I am trying to build power unit that runs off of heat like the refrigerator in some campers I have a large wood burning heater  that heats my water for radiant tubing and my shower water it has a very thick wall pipe running through it to heat the Freon then a metering valve. I should mention it has a one way valve before it goes in to the heater.   It will heat the Freon creating a lot of pressure it then goes through the metering valve for regulating the drive motor.   From drive motor to oil separator to expansion chamber to cool it down then out through copper tubing running through the back yard.   Then back to heater. It will have a bypass valve and pop off valves for safety
 The part I’m not sure about is how I should build the expansion chamber  I will want to run  at least two evaporates for some cool in the house but that is an after though    The main thing is it runs a generator.  To clarify.   A little more my drive motor is a power steering pump off of a Peterbilt I used to have.     An air starter might be better but most of those you can’t plumb out of they just bleed their air off to the atmosphere.  I push about 30 psi. Through this power steering pump at the pressure port it was strong enough to wear good little hole in my tennis shoe when I tried to hold it down.  Any thoughts  or comments would be welcome  best regards mike

MikeYou are very creative in terms of using the hydraulic pressure to try to drive something as well as explore an alternative heat driven refrigeration pumping system.Those camper units that run off propane or even kerosine wick burners use ammonia based refrigerants, in most cases.It is not a path often travelledI have used hydraulic motors for various uses, running a scuba tank compressor, a generator, and an anchor winch, all of which, I built myself.Some makes of pumps can also be motors, depending whether they are driving,, or driven, much the same as permanent magnet dc motorsThe big issue is compatibility of seals, torque required, and a big failure of hydraulic motors, maximumum speed.
There are high speed hydraulic motors, but they are not all that common.Cheers Warren
